| Subject: [PATCH] Use uintmax_t for handling rlim_t |
| |
| PRIu{32,64} is not right format to represent rlim_t type |
| therefore use %ju and typecast the rlim_t variables to |
| uintmax_t. |
| |
| Fixes portablility errors like |
| |
| execute.c:3446:36: error: format '%lu' expects argument of type 'long unsigned int', but argument 5 has type 'rlim_t {aka long long unsigned int}' [-Werror=format=] |
| | fprintf(f, "%s%s: " RLIM_FMT "\n", |
| | ^~~~~~~~ |
| | prefix, rlimit_to_string(i), c->rlimit[i]->rlim_max); |
| | ~~~~~~~~~~~~~~~~~~~~~~ |
| |
| Upstream-Status: Denied [https://github.com/systemd/systemd/pull/7199] |
